We explored the working principle of Archimedes screw. Let us look at The coil pump which was built as an alternative to the Archimedean screw. This pump allows the lifting of water over a small height.
Let us build a coil pump with PVC Pipe and plastic tubing to understand its working.
4 meters of plastic tube is wrapped around the PVC pipe.
Let us add some ink and soap solution to the water. This will enable us to see how water moves inside the pipe as we rotate it.
As I rotate the pipe once, water enters in the first section. As water tends to be at the lowest level, it moves forward one turn each rotation. This movement continues till it reaches the other end. We can dip the tube halfway and see how the second part moves up as well.
If you dont have long plastic tube, You can use bend straws and square shaped bottle as well to build a similar arrangement.
Understand more about coil pump with these variations.
Instead of wrapping it around the pipe, you can attach a plastic tube on a circular PVC sheet and form a spiral. When the sheet is rotated, water travels all the way up to the center and comes out.
Instead of my hand rotating the wheel, flowing water or wind power can be used to rotate this wheel and we can build a pump which does not need electricity !
Just like a coil pump, water can be lifted over a small height.
With the help of an O ring, you can attach another pipe here and transport water to a remote place.
